Photo Essay: Revisit the Midcentury Classics of Palm Springs and Beyond

Turning a new eye toward the landmarks and the legends of the desert modern oasis (and its neighbors).

If you’ve ever studied Palm Springs’s wealth of modernist architecture, you probably imagine that every house in every neighborhood sports the same profile: butterfly roof, pierced concrete block screens, post-and-beam open plan. And if you’re thinking of Vista Las Palmas or Racquet Club Estates, you’re right.
